>I'm having the idea of running a prg file when my application start, where I put it as "Set Main" in my Project Info. Then I'll change the icon and screen title of my program, and close other unnecessary windows like Command or so..
>
>But, there's something which is very simple that I'm still doubt about. Now, I'm having my menu.mnx file Set As Main. Can I run my menu from a prg file? I've find the help in VFP and only found Activate menu, which seems that I need to define everything for the menu, but not running a complete designed menu file.
>

Just construct it with the Menu Builder and DO name of menu file.MPR
